Officers undergo “de-contamination”

Two Oconee sheriff’s officers are undergoing a de-contamination process today after reporting headaches and burning of the skin, as they attempted to carry out an eviction today in the Fair Play community. Sheriff Mike Crenshaw says the officers were being given showers at the community’s volunteer fire station. No one was home at the Fair Play house, to which the officers carried eviction papers. The immediate suspicion is that there may have been methamphetamine on the premises, and Crenshaw says his office is obtaining a search warrant for the house.
